Deep Blue Sea (The)

Country: UK, Language: English, 98 mins

  • Director: Terence Davies
  • Writer: Terence Davies; Terence Rattigan
  • Producer: Katherine Butler; Eliza Mellor

CGiii Comment

Rattigan and Davies are both gay...that's the only CGiii element to this film.

Rachel Weisz is quite exceptional in the role.

Many scenes are beautifully composed.

The reason why it was adapted and re-made is not quite clear.

The(ir) Blurb...

The wife of a British Judge is caught in a self-destructive love affair with a Royal Air Force pilot.
